First Book of Martin & St. Lucie Counties and Ms. Florida, Dr. Juli Goldstein- Together to Promote Literacy

(Stuart, FL) - Saturday, August 29th -Ms. Florida, Dr. Juli Goldstein will read to children on Saturday, August 29 th, from 10 a.m. until 12 p.m. at Harborage Yacht Club for a Reading Rally hosted by First Book of Martin & St. Lucie Counties.There are many children from low-income families living in Martin & St. Lucie Counties with little or no access to books. With the support of Dr. Juli Goldstein and the community, First Book of Martin & St. Lucie Counties is working to put new books into the hands of children in need.

"I am delighted to partner with First Book of Martin & St. Lucie Counties to bring books to the children in this community", stated Dr. Juli Goldstein. "By working together, we can end illiteracy in Martin & St. Lucie Counties."

First Book of Martin & St. Lucie Counties is part of First Book's national network of volunteer-led Advisory Boards who provide new books to children in need in communities across the country. Comprised of volunteers from all sectors of the community, First Book of Martin & St. Lucie Counties works to promote and facilitate the distribution of new books to children of literacy programs in the Martin & St. Lucie areas. Access to books is essential to reading development. However, 61 percent of low-income families have no books for children in their homes. Additionally, over 80 percent of childcare centers serving low-income children lack age-appropriate books and other print materials. By providing children from low-income families with books they can take home and keep, First Book targets the only variable that correlates significantly with reading scores-the number of books in the home.

About First Book - Martin & St. Lucie Counties

First Book of Martin & St. Lucie Counties has been distributing books to programs serving low-income children since 2008. In 2008, First Book of Martin & St. Lucie Counties distributed over 4,000books to children participating in programs including Indiantown Middle School and Future Generations of St. Lucie County. First Book of Martin & St. Lucie Counties meet every month at the Stuart Fire Rescue Station 1.
